Parking Lot Excavation in Salt Lake City, UT
Parking lot excavation services involve the removal and preparation of soil, gravel, or existing pavement to create a stable foundation for new parking areas or driveways. These services are commonly utilized for constructing new parking lots, expanding existing spaces, or preparing surfaces for asphalt or concrete paving. Property owners typically seek excavation to ensure proper drainage, level surfaces, and a solid base that supports heavy vehicles while preventing future issues like uneven settling or water pooling.
Before requesting parking lot excavation, property owners should consider the size and scope of the project, including the total area to be excavated and any existing structures or underground utilities that might impact work. Understanding local regulations or permits required for excavation work can also be important. Clear communication about the desired outcome and any specific site conditions helps 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ets the property’s needs.

Parking Lot Excavation Questions
What is parking lot excavation? It involves removing soil, debris, and existing materials to prepare the area for new pavement or surfacing.
What types of projects require excavation services? Projects include new parking lots, expanding existing spaces, or resurfacing areas with significant ground adjustments.
What should property owners consider before excavation? It's important to evaluate the site’s soil conditions, drainage needs, and any underground utilities.
How does excavation impact the overall parking lot installation? Proper excavation ensures a stable foundation, leading to a longer-lasting and properly leveled surface.
